#9c225f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9c225f is composed of 61.2% red, 13.3%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.2% magenta, 39.1%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 330 degrees, a saturation of 64.2% and a lightness of 37.3%. #9c225f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ff44be with #390000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#9c225f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9c225f has RGB values of R:156, G:34, B:95 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.78, Y:0.39,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 10232415.

Shades and Tints of #9c225f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0207 is the darkest color, while #fefaf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#9c225f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#625c5f is the less saturated color, while #b9055f is the most saturated one.
